Junior Drilling Supervisor (Night DSV)

Key Responsibilities

  • Supervise and coordinate all drilling and well-site activities during the night shift.
  • Ensure operations are conducted in accordance with the approved drilling program and well objectives.
  • Work under the direction of the Senior Drilling Supervisor and maintain continuity between day and night operations.
  • Monitor drilling parameters and operational performance throughout the shift.
  • Coordinate activities between the Rig Manager, Driller, Mud Engineer, Directional Driller, MWD/LWD personnel, Cementing and other well-service companies.
  • Ensure all drilling activities are conducted safely and efficiently.
  • Verify that approved procedures, work instructions, risk assessments, and Job Safety Analyses are followed.
  • Participate in pre-job meetings, toolbox talks, and shift handover meetings.
  • Maintain effective communication with the Driller and rig crew throughout critical operations.
  • Monitor progress against the drilling program and report any deviation or operational concern.
  • Immediately escalate significant operational, safety, well-control, or equipment issues to the Senior Drilling Supervisor.

Drilling Operations

Monitor and supervise drilling activities including, where applicable:

  • Rig-up and rig-down operations.
  • Spud and conductor operations.
  • Drilling and hole-cleaning activities.
  • Tripping operations.
  • BHA make-up and running.
  • Drill pipe and tubular handling.
  • Casing running operations.
  • Cementing operations.
  • Well-control activities.
  • Pressure testing.
  • Formation evaluation and logging operations.
  • Directional drilling operations.
  • Mud-system activities.
  • Wellhead and BOP-related operations.
  • Completion and well-intervention activities as assigned.

Well Control Responsibilities

  • Maintain a strong awareness of well-control requirements throughout drilling operations.
  • Monitor drilling parameters for indications of potential well-control events.
  • Ensure well-control procedures are followed.
  • Monitor pit volumes, flow rates, trip sheets, pump pressure, returns, and other relevant indicators.
  • Ensure appropriate actions are taken in accordance with the approved well-control procedures when abnormal conditions are identified.
  • Participate in well-control drills and exercises.
  • Ensure the rig crew maintains readiness for well-control situations.
  • Immediately report any suspected kick, loss, influx, abnormal pressure, or other well-control concern to the Senior Drilling Supervisor.
  • Support implementation of the well-control response plan as directed.

HSE Responsibilities

  • Demonstrate visible leadership in Health, Safety, and Environmental performance.
  • Ensure all night-shift activities comply with company and client HSE requirements.
  • Monitor compliance with Permit to Work (PTW), JSA, risk assessments, and safe work procedures.
  • Conduct or participate in toolbox talks and pre-job safety meetings.
  • Identify unsafe acts and conditions and take appropriate corrective action.
  • Exercise Stop Work Authority when an activity presents an unacceptable risk.
  • Monitor critical activities such as lifting, working at height, pressure testing, hot work, confined-space entry, and simultaneous operations.
  • Ensure appropriate PPE is used by all personnel.
  • Report incidents, near misses, unsafe conditions, and environmental events.
  • Support emergency response activities and participate in emergency drills.

Night Shift Supervision

The Night DSV is responsible for maintaining effective operational control during the night shift and ensuring a proper handover to the day team.

Responsibilities include

  • Conduct a detailed shift handover with the outgoing DSV.
  • Review current well status, drilling parameters, operational objectives, and planned activities.
  • Review outstanding operational and HSE issues.
  • Monitor critical equipment and service-company activities.
  • Coordinate night-shift personnel and service contractors.
  • Maintain clear communication with the Senior Drilling Supervisor and relevant support functions.
  • Prepare a comprehensive shift report for the incoming DSV.
  • Highlight any abnormal conditions, delays, operational risks, or deviations from the drilling program.
  • Ensure all relevant operational data and documentation are accurately recorded.
